Features Editor, Science News

Science News Media Group seeks an experienced and creative editor to manage longform journalism for our award-winning publication. The role includes working with colleagues across the newsroom to set a long-range strategy for the feature well, including thinking strategically about covers, innovating on formats and prioritizing the digital expression of print-first content. The Features Editor will guide staff writers and freelancers to develop and deliver must-read narratives across the fields of science that will connect readers with the most significant, must-know advances in science, medicine and technology while providing context, nuance and perspective on how science impacts people’s lives, communities and the planet. Working with the Managing Editor, this role will set and enforce deadlines, aid in production work, adapt work from other departments for the magazine and work closely with the Design Team to ensure all assigned stories have top-notch visuals.

Science News Media Group is an editorially independent nonprofit news organization that has been covering news of science, medicine and technology for the general public since 1921. The magazine has a circulation of more than 120,000, and we drew almost 10 million unique visitors in 2025 to sciencenews.orgScience News consistently ranks as the most trusted and least biased science news organization in Ad Fontes Media’s biannual analysis. We also publish Science News Explores, a website and print magazine with more than 30,000 subscribers that connects younger people and educators with science.

Our parent nonprofit Society for Science is dedicated to expanding scientific literacy, access to STEM education and public understanding of scientific research. As a nonprofit 501(c)(3) membership organization, the Society promotes the understanding and appreciation of science and the vital role it plays in human advancement: to inform, educate, and inspire. Beyond journalism, the Society is best known for its world class science research competitions and outreach and equity STEM Programs founded to make sure that every young person can strive to become an engineer or scientist.

Responsibilities

  • Set and maintain an editorial calendar for longform stories, most of which will appear first in print in our monthly magazine
  • Solicit pitches from staff writers and freelancers; develop, assign and edit compelling features that fit the Science News brand
  • Recruit and coach freelance editors who can assist with feature edits
  • Collaborate with the Design Team to identify or create photos, illustrations, charts, diagrams, infographics, etc. that adhere to the highest standards for accuracy
  • Collaborate with the Design Team to ensure that all features have layouts that enhance the storytelling
  • Collaborate with the News Team on adapting longer news analyses or explainers for print
  • Collaborate with the Digital Team to imagine and enact new strategies for longform pieces online, including innovative formats, interactives and other multimedia
  • Work with managers across the newsroom to balance staff workloads and set priorities
  • Guide features through fact checks and print production in InCopy
  • Assist with other magazine production tasks as needed
  • Edit web-first news stories as needed
  • Supervise staff writers

Qualifications

  • Expertise in editing and producing longform journalism
  • Ability to plan and execute a strategy for features and covers 12 months out, balancing the need to cover a variety of topics in each issue with the goal of providing a cohesive reader experience
  • Strong work ethic and time management skills
  • Knowledge of the ethics and standards of a news organization
  • Organization and experience prioritizing across multiple projects
  • Exceptional communications skills
  • Ability to develop rapport with colleagues and freelancers
  • Interest in and familiarity with recent developments in science

Required Education and Experience

  • Bachelor’s degree or equivalent experience
  • At least 7 years’ experience editing, including longform
  • Experience working on consumer magazines
  • Experience supervising and mentoring writers
  • Excellent teamworking skills
  • Knowledge of Adobe Suite products; InCopy preferred
